Historical & Cultural Background

The name Joela has its roots in Hebrew, derived from the name Yoel, which means "Yahweh is God." The name Yoel appears in the Hebrew Bible, where it is associated with the prophet Joel, who authored the Book of Joel, a text that is part of the Twelve Minor Prophets. The transition from Yoel to Joela likely occurred through the adaptation of Hebrew names into various languages, including Greek and Latin, before being absorbed into English.

The feminine form Joela can be seen as a derivative that maintains the original meaning while adapting to gender conventions in naming practices. Historically, the name Joel has been significant in Judeo-Christian traditions, with the prophet Joel being recognized for his apocalyptic visions and calls for repentance.

The Book of Joel has been influential in both religious and literary contexts, particularly during the Middle Ages when biblical texts were translated into vernacular languages. The name Joela, while less common, can be traced back to these traditions, reflecting the enduring legacy of biblical names in various cultures.

Culturally, names derived from biblical figures often carry connotations of faith, spirituality, and moral integrity. The name Joela, as a feminine variant, resonates with the same themes of devotion and divine connection.

In some traditions, the use of diminutive forms or variations, such as Jo or Joelle, has emerged, although these are not as historically significant as the original forms. Overall, Joela encapsulates a rich linguistic and cultural heritage, linking it to ancient texts and the broader narrative of religious history.
